Introduction to DeFi Protocols
Decentralized Finance (DeFi) is transforming the financial landscape by leveraging blockchain technology to create open, permissionless, and transparent financial systems. Unlike traditional finance, which relies on centralized institutions like banks, DeFi protocols operate on smart contracts, primarily on Ethereum, enabling peer-to-peer financial services. Among the most popular DeFi applications are lending, borrowing, and yield farming. This article breaks down these core concepts, how they work, and their role in the Web 3 ecosystem.
What Are DeFi Protocols?
DeFi protocols are blockchain-based applications that facilitate financial transactions without intermediaries. Built on smart contracts, these protocols automate processes like lending, borrowing, and trading, ensuring transparency and security. They operate on decentralized networks, allowing anyone with an internet connection and a crypto wallet to participate. Popular DeFi platforms include Aave, Compound, and Uniswap, each offering unique features for users seeking financial opportunities in Web 3.
Lending in DeFi
How It Works
In DeFi, lending allows users to supply cryptocurrencies to liquidity pools, which are then used to facilitate loans. Lenders earn interest, typically paid in the same cryptocurrency or a protocol-specific token. Smart contracts govern the terms, such as interest rates and collateral requirements, eliminating the need for a bank.
- Process: Users deposit assets (e.g., ETH, DAI) into a protocol like Aave or Compound. These assets are pooled and made available for borrowing. Lenders earn interest based on the pool’s utilization rate, which fluctuates with demand.
- Example: Depositing 100 DAI into Compound might yield 5% annual interest, paid out in real-time as borrowers use the pool.
Benefits of DeFi Lending
- Accessibility: Anyone with crypto assets can lend, no credit checks required.
- Passive Income: Earn interest without active management.
- Transparency: Interest rates and terms are visible on the blockchain.
Risks
- Smart Contract Bugs: Vulnerabilities in code can lead to hacks or loss of funds.
- Market Volatility: Asset prices can fluctuate, affecting returns.
- Liquidity Risks: High demand may temporarily lock funds in pools.
Borrowing in DeFi
How It Works
DeFi borrowing allows users to take out loans in cryptocurrencies by providing collateral, typically at a higher value than the borrowed amount (over-collateralization). Smart contracts enforce repayment terms, and if collateral value drops below a threshold, it may be liquidated to cover the loan.
- Process: A user deposits collateral (e.g., ETH) into a protocol like MakerDAO, then borrows a stablecoin like DAI. The loan-to-value (LTV) ratio determines how much can be borrowed (e.g., 50% LTV means $100 of ETH collateral allows borrowing up to $50).
- Example: Borrowing 500 DAI against 1 ETH (worth $2,000) on Aave, with interest rates set by market dynamics.
Benefits of DeFi Borrowing
- No Credit Checks: Borrowing is based on collateral, not credit history.
- Flexibility: Use borrowed funds for trading, investing, or other DeFi activities.
- Global Access: Available to anyone with a crypto wallet.
Risks
- Liquidation Risk: If collateral value drops, assets may be sold off to cover the loan.
- Interest Rate Volatility: Variable rates can increase borrowing costs.
- Over-Collateralization: Users must lock up more value than they borrow, tying up capital.
Yield Farming Explained
How It Works
Yield farming, also known as liquidity mining, involves providing liquidity to DeFi protocols (e.g., decentralized exchanges like Uniswap) in exchange for rewards, often in the form of governance tokens. Farmers deposit assets into liquidity pools, which facilitate trading or lending, and earn returns from trading fees or token rewards.
- Process: A user deposits a token pair (e.g., ETH/USDT) into a Uniswap pool. They receive liquidity provider (LP) tokens, which can be staked in a yield farming protocol to earn additional rewards, such as UNI tokens.
- Example: Providing $10,000 of ETH/DAI to a pool might yield 0.3% of trading fees plus governance tokens, potentially generating 10-50% annualized returns.
Benefits of Yield Farming
- High Returns: Yields can exceed traditional investments, especially in new protocols.
- Token Incentives: Earn governance tokens that may appreciate in value.
- Flexibility: Withdraw liquidity at any time (subject to protocol rules).
Risks
- Impermanent Loss: Price changes between paired tokens can reduce returns.
- Rug Pulls: Some protocols may be scams, with developers draining funds.
- High Volatility: Token rewards and asset prices can fluctuate wildly.
Key DeFi Platforms for Lending, Borrowing, and Yield Farming
- Aave: A leading lending and borrowing protocol with variable and stable interest rates, supporting flash loans for advanced users.
- Compound: A lending platform where users earn COMP tokens for supplying or borrowing assets.
- Uniswap: A decentralized exchange for yield farming via liquidity pools, rewarding users with trading fees and UNI tokens.
- MakerDAO: A protocol for borrowing DAI against collateral, with a focus on stablecoin stability.
- Curve Finance: Optimized for stablecoin yield farming, offering low-slippage trades and high yields.
Getting Started with DeFi
To participate in DeFi lending, borrowing, or yield farming:
- Set Up a Wallet: Use a non-custodial wallet like MetaMask or Trust Wallet.
- Acquire Crypto: Purchase ETH or stablecoins (e.g., USDC, DAI) via exchanges like Coinbase or Binance.
- Connect to a DeFi Protocol: Visit platforms like Aave or Uniswap, connect your wallet, and deposit assets.
- Understand Risks: Research smart contract audits, protocol reputation, and market conditions.
- Start Small: Test with a small amount to learn the mechanics before scaling up.
Risks and Challenges in DeFi
While DeFi offers exciting opportunities, it comes with significant risks:
- Smart Contract Vulnerabilities: Bugs or exploits can lead to fund losses, as seen in hacks like the 2021 Poly Network exploit.
- Regulatory Uncertainty: Governments may impose regulations, affecting DeFi operations.
- Market Risks: Crypto volatility can impact collateral values and yields.
- Complexity: DeFi requires technical knowledge, which can be a barrier for beginners.
The Future of DeFi in Web 3
DeFi is a cornerstone of Web 3, enabling financial inclusion and innovation. As blockchain technology evolves, we can expect:
- Improved Scalability: Layer 2 solutions like Optimism and Arbitrum will reduce gas fees and increase transaction speeds.
- Cross-Chain DeFi: Protocols like Polkadot and Cosmos enable interoperability between blockchains.
- Mainstream Adoption: User-friendly interfaces and education will drive broader participation.
Conclusion
DeFi protocols for lending, borrowing, and yield farming are revolutionizing finance by offering decentralized, transparent, and accessible alternatives to traditional systems. By understanding how these mechanisms work and their associated risks, you can confidently explore the DeFi ecosystem. Whether you’re a developer building dApps or an investor seeking passive income, DeFi is a powerful tool in the Web 3 landscape. Start small, stay informed, and dive into the future of finance.